Husband and wife PI team Helen Hawthorne and Phil Sagemont both have their hands full, but only Helen has to carry drink trays—as part of her latest undercover assignment as a stewardess on a private yacht Lost at SeaTo catch a jewel smuggler on a luxury yacht, Helen needs to pose as the ships new stewardess—but between serving drinks to the snobs, scrubbing floors, and cleaning up after seasick passengers, shes starting to miss dry land almost as much as she misses Phil.While Helens cruising to the Bahamas, Phils got his own job—trying to catch a sexy gold digger who may have killed her elderly husband for his fortune. Good thing hes a self-proclaimed master of disguise, playing it cool as everything from an air-conditioning repairman to a Rastafarian.
